CVE-2023-5010

CVE-2023-5010 is a high-severity vulnerability in Kashipara Student Information System with a CVSS 3.x base score of 8.8. It is not currently listed as actively exploited by CISA, and its EPSS exploit-prediction score is low. The underlying weakness is classified as CWE-89.

Key facts

Description

Student Information System v1.0 is vulnerable to multiple Authenticated SQL Injection vulnerabilities. The 'coursecode' parameter of the marks.php resource does not validate the characters received and they are sent unfiltered to the database.

How severe is CVE-2023-5010?
CVE-2023-5010 has a CVSS 3.x base score of 8.8, rated high severity. It is exploitable over network with low attack complexity, requires low privileges and no user interaction. Impact on confidentiality is high, integrity high, and availability high.
Is CVE-2023-5010 being actively exploited?
It is not currently listed in CISA's KEV catalog. Its EPSS exploit-prediction score is 1% (48th percentile), an estimate of the probability of exploitation in the next 30 days.
